Evaluating When to Repair vs. Replace Your Air Conditioning
Deciding whether to repair or replace your AC isn’t always straightforward. Consider the following points to help your decision:
- Age of the System: In general, your average air conditioner is designed to last about 8-12 years. The older the system is, the greater the chance of sudden failure when you need it most.
- Frequency of Repairs: Regular repairs can be costly. If you're constantly servicing your AC, switching to a new unit could be the wise choice.
- Performance and Features of New Systems: Today's air conditioners offer increased functionality and greater energy efficiency. While your existing unit might still be running, getting a replacement is still often the better option.
